The authors experience is presented in this work, in which we have implemented a methodology that aims to ensure the quality of the measurements taken in experimental practices of physics laboratory courses targeted at the basic training of engineering students from the Technological University of Pereira (UTP). To meet this goal, students are located from the course of Physics Laboratory 1, within the context of national and international standards that exist around the metrological themes and vocabulary, and are introduced to the application of a generic methodology for estimation of measurement uncertainty of the experimental results. This methodology has been designed and implemented with the aim of creating a culture around this issue. The methodology is based on the GUM "Guide to the Expression of Uncertainty in Measurement" published by the ISO, which is used for scientific, industrial and legal level, where the proper handling of the measuring equipment and proper expression of their measurements is of utmost importance in the context of quality and competitiveness.
